Ideagen Acquires Optima Diagnostics For Nearly GBP2 Million

11th Oct 2019 10:21

(Alliance News) - Ideagen PLC on Friday said it bought Optima Diagnostics Ltd for GBP1.8 million in cash, which will be paid upon completion from the company's existing resources.

Optima is a software-as-a-service company that has developed Oshens, a health & safety compliance solution.

The management software supplier said on a current run rate Optima is generating GBP1 million in revenue, and earnings before interest, taxes, depreciation, and amortization of GBP100,000.

Ideagen said it expects the acquisition to contribute GBP300,000 additional annual Ebitda to the enlarged company following the realisation of identified synergies.

"Optima is a valuable addition to Ideagen and is in line with our strategy of acquiring businesses that have strong intellectual property and recurring revenue," said Ideagen Executive Chair David Hornsby.

"The global quality, health, safety and environmental software is a valuable yet fragmented market and the acquisition will further enhance our market position as we aim to further consolidate this sector," added Hornsby.

Ideagen shares were trading 0.3% lower on Friday in London at 148.60 pence each.
